The Kindle Fire doesn't have a traditional file explorer like desktop computers, but you can still access your downloads through the Apps section. First, open your Kindle Fire and tap on the Apps icon from the home screen. Then, swipe from right to left to view the 'Downloads' tab. Here you'll see all your recently downloaded apps and files. Alternatively, you can use the 'Files' app if your Kindle Fire model supports it, which provides a more comprehensive file management experience similar to what you'd find on a computer.

How to Use
To access your downloads, open the Apps section and swipe to the Downloads tab. Tap on any file to open it or long-press to delete, share, or move files. For more advanced file management, install the 'Files by Google' app from the Amazon Appstore for a full-featured file explorer experience.
